Unit 1 Bargaining Update for Friday, August 23, 2019
Unit 1 Bargaining Team Reaches Tentative Agreement on EDD Post and Bid Agreement and EDD Determination Scheduling Standard Agreement

On Wednesday, August 21, the Unit 1 bargaining team continued their negotiations with the State by reaching a tentative agreement (TA) on Post and Bid Agreement and the EDD Determination Scheduling Standard at the Employment Development Department (EDD).

Earlier in the bargaining process, Unit 1 negotiators proposed to “roll-over” the current Post and Bid provision at EDD. The state countered with anti-nepotism language that would allow management to deny Post and Bid placements if they were found to be based on favoritism.

Unit 1/Unit 4 Joint Bargaining Update for Wednesday, August 21st, 2019
Units 1 and 4 Reach Important Agreement on Lottery Bonus Procedures

Meeting in a special joint “side table” with the state, Units 1 and 4 fought for and won a major advance for Lottery employees on Wednesday, August 21. The advance stands to update and improve the bonus structure for its field sales representatives in Unit 1 and the lottery ticket sales specialist series in Unit 4.

These are the workers on the front lines who drive Lottery revenues that contribute more than $1 billion annually to the state’s public schools and help create a California for All.

Unit 3 Bargaining Update for Wednesday, August 21st, 2019
Career Technical Education Instructors in CDCR Win Clarifying Language on Initial Placements

On Wednesday, August 21, Unit 3’s bargaining team signed a tentative agreement (TA) that clarifies the process by which Career Technical Education (CTE) Instructors are initially placed on the unit’s salary schedule. This new language will ensure that CTE instructors are assessed and placed in the schedule on equal footing with Academic instructors.

Unit 3 Bargaining Update for Wednesday, August 7th, 2019
Unit 3 Signs Agreements Preserving Professional Status, Prep Time and Personal Days

Our Unit 3 bargaining team recorded some important wins for the Professional Educators and Librarians in state service. And in doing so, the team laid the groundwork for securing a contract that creates a California for All.

“This was a long-fought and fruitful day for our team and our members,” said Terry Hibbard, Unit 3 bargaining chair. “In all, we signed 19 different tentative agreements that preserve our wins from previous contract campaigns.”
